Turkey AI Computer Vision Market Outlook

  • In 2024, the market in Turkey held a value of USD 226.3 million.
  • The Turkey AI Computer Vision Market will be USD 2.17 billion by 2033, backed by a CAGR of 26.8% during the forecast period.

Industry Assessment Overview

Industry Findings: Rapid industrial upgrading and logistics expansion make retrofit-friendly vision solutions the core commercial differentiator. The market rewards vendors who can deploy across heterogeneous production lines and logistics corridors, offering flexible mounting, easy calibration, and rapid model adaptation for new SKUs. Those who simplify integration with local system integrators and provide regional support are winning larger enterprise and public-sector programs.

Industry Progression: National strategy and coordinated industrial policy are converting AI intent into procurement pipelines for vision-enabled manufacturing and public services, because government-led frameworks provide budgetary clarity and testbeds; Turkey’s National AI Strategy (NAIS 2021–2025) and follow-on programme activities have channelled funding and pilot opportunities into robotics and inspection use cases, incentivising vendors to localise solutions, demonstrate compliance, and partner with Turkish system integrators to capture expanding enterprise and public tenders.

Industry Players: A large number of providers operate in Turkey including Aselsan, Vestel, Havelsan, Turkcell, STM, Arçelik, and Roketsan etc. Insight: Domestic defence and industrial investment is reshaping civilian vision demand toward suppliers able to scale production and certify at national level; Aselsan’s announcement in August 2025 of a $1.5 billion Ogulbey technology base to double capacity points to accelerated local manufacture and systems integration for sensor and vision hardware. That August 2025 commitment reduces supply-chain friction for high-assurance camera systems, favours vendors who can co-manufacture or certify locally, and shortens procurement cycles for large industrial and municipal CV programmes that require domestic sourcing and long-term maintenance guarantees.
